Marion Has Four Styles Of Shaft Seals. Clean-Ability and Maintenance Requirements Will Determine the Appropriate Seal Selection.

Style E-Stuffing Box Seal

  • A machined, barrel housing is welded to the mixer end plate
  • A UHMW washer and 4 woven TFE packing seals are used
  • The adjustable packing gland is field tightened to accommodate packing wear
  • Air purge feature helps prevent migration of material along the shaft
  • Ideal for most applications with periodic maintenance requirements
  • Machined seal housing equipped with threaded air purge connection
  • Standard on all chopper shaft applications

Style E - Split Seal

  • Machined seal housing is designed for quick disassembly and clean-out
  • Adjustable "finger knobs" allow maintenance without the use of tools
  • TFE/ synthetic or "food grade" Teflon packing materials are used
  • Machined seal plate is attached to the mixer end plate with no exposed cracks or crevices
  • Optional air purge is available to prevent migration of materials along the shaft
  • Ideal for sanitary applications where frequent cleaning is required
  • Machined mounting plate creates sanitary interface with mixer
  • Food grade packing materials are available

Mechanical Seal

  • Seals use mechanical interference of machined parts to prevent migration of material along the shaft
  • Air or liquid purge options are available
  • Once installed and adjusted, mechanical seals require less periodic maintenance
  • Mechanical seals are designed to accommodate greater amounts of shaft run-out
  • Ideal for liquid or pressure applications
  • Precision machined components

Style B - Inside/Outside Seal

  • Cast iron seal housings are through-bolted on either side of the mixer end plate
  • The housings are machined to accept either felt or woven TFE/synthetic packing
  • An oil lubricant port is piped to the exterior of the mixer
  • This rugged seal design is well suited for abrasive environments with dry materials
  • Single or double seal designs
  • Oil impregnated felt packing is compressed around shaft
  • Oil or grease lubricant is piped from seal housing
